中文The statistics on depression are staggering. In this article you will learn more about the prevalence of depression and related mental health disorders in the nation and in the world at large.
According to studies conducted and published in the Journal of the American Medical Association, the World Health Organization and information gathered from the National Institute of Mental Health, the Depression and Bipolar Support Alliance, the Center for Mental Health Services, and Brown University Long Term Care Quarterly, the following are true of people with depression.
General Depression Statistics
- Recent statistics suggest roughly seven of every one hundred people suffer depression after age 18 at some point in their lives.
- As many as one in 33 children and one in eight adolescents have clinical depression. Suicide is the third leading cause of death for ages 10 to 24.
- Most people diagnosed with major depression receive a diagnosis between their late twenties to mid-thirties.
- About six million people are affected by late life depression, but only 10% ever receive treatment.
- For every one man that develops depression, two women will, regardless of racial or ethnic background or economic status.
- More than half of all people caring for an older relative show clinically significant depressive symptoms.
- By the year 2020, depression will be the 2nd most common health problem in the world.
Statistics on Depression and Other Diseases
- Depression often exists with other diseases, including chronic pain, arthritis, diabetes and HIV patients.
- Depression is also known to weaken the immune system, making the body more susceptible to other medical illnesses.
- People with depression are four times as likely to develop a heart attack than those without a history of the illness. After a heart attack, they are at a significantly increased risk of death or second heart attack.
- 25% of cancer patients experience depression.
- 10-27% of post-stroke patients experience depression.
- 1 in 3 heart attack survivors experience depression.
- Almost half of all patients with Parkinson’s suffer from depression, ranging from mild to moderate.
- Approximately one of every two patients with an eating disorder suffers from major or clinical depression.
- 27% of individuals with substance abuse disorders (both alcohol and other substances) experience depression.
- Depression may increase a woman’s risk for broken bones.
Statistics on the Economic Impact of Depression
- Major depressive disorder is the leading cause of disability in the U.S. for ages 15-44.
- Clinical or major depression is the top cause of disability throughout the world for persons 5 and over.
- In the United States alone, businesses may spend anywhere from twelve to seventy billion dollars caring for or paying for the medical expenses of employees that have depression or suffer from a related mental illness.
Getting Help
Here is the good news however: depression is one of the most treatable illnesses – 80-90% find relief. Researchers diligently work to develop new and successful treatments for depression among all age groups. Studies suggest patients that seek treatment, whether from psychotherapy, medication therapy, holistic therapy or a combination of these, as many as eighty percent or more improve dramatically. Unfortunately, many people with depression still suffer in silence, perhaps because they do not recognize the symptoms of depression or feel they cannot afford medical treatment for their disease.

关于抑郁症的统计是惊人的。在这篇文章中,你会看到抑郁症和相关的精神紊乱在美国和全世界有多么地普遍。
下列的统计数据是跟据美国医学协会杂志(Journal of the American Medical Association)和世界卫生组织(World Health Organization)发表的调查结果和从美国精神健康学院(National Institute of Mental Health)、抑郁症和燥郁症支持联盟(Depression and Bipolar Support Alliance)、精神健康服务中心(Center for Mental Health Services)、和布朗大学长期护理季刊(Brown University Long Term Care Quarterly)搜集的资料整编的。
关于抑郁症的一般统计数据
- 近期的统计表明大约7%的人在18岁后会在一生中的某个时刻得抑郁症。
- 33个儿童当中就有一个,8个青少年当中就有一个患临床抑郁症。自杀是10到24岁年龄段中第三大死因。
- 大多数的严重抑郁症患者是在二十几岁到三十多岁之间得到确诊的。
- 大约六百万的人受到老年抑郁症的影响,但只有10%的人得到医治。
- 对每一个患抑郁症的男士,就有两个患抑郁症的女士。这跟种族、民族、或经济条件无关。
- 在照顾年老亲友的人当中,一半多的人有明显的抑郁症状。
- 到2020年, 抑郁症将会成为全世界第二大最普遍的健康问题
关于抑郁症和别的疾病关联的统计
- 抑郁症通常是与别的疾病同存的,包括慢性疼痛、关节炎、糖尿病和HIV。
- 抑郁症会减弱免疫系统、容易得别的疫病。
- 抑郁症患者心脏病发作的几率是常人的四倍。在心脏病第一次发作后,第二次发作或死亡的几率会大大地增高。
- 25%的癌症病人会经历抑郁症。
- 10-27%的中风病人会经历抑郁症。
- 1/3的心脏病发作幸存者会经历抑郁症。
- 几乎一半的帕金森患者会得轻度到中度的抑郁症。
- 大约一半的饮食失调患者有严重(临床)抑郁症。
- 27% 的酗酒和滥用药物的病人有抑郁症。
- 抑郁症可能会增加妇女骨折的危险。
抑郁症对经济影响的统计
- 在美国严重抑郁症是15到44岁年龄段导致残废的主要原因。
- 临床或严重抑郁症是全世界导致5岁以上人残废的主要原因。
- 单单在美国,企业化在得抑郁症或相关的疾病的员工的医疗费用是在120亿到700亿之间。
